{"title":"Chatgpt 对前端开发的影响,重点是 Reactjs","authors":"Abubakar Bachtiar, Rian Andrian","doi":"10.37676/jmcs.v3i1.4361","DOIUrl":null,"url":null,"abstract":"This article analyzes the impact of using ChatGPT in front-end development with a focus on the ReactJS framework. Through interviews with front-end developers who have used ChatGPT, we evaluate their experience implementing ChatGPT in web application development with ReactJS.The results of the analysis show that using ChatGPT in front-end development, especially with ReactJS, has a positive impact. Developers report significant improvements in development speed, a wider range of idea exploration capabilities, and an increase in overall productivity. They appreciated ChatGPT's ability to provide coding suggestions and solutions that helped speed up the development process.However, several challenges were also identified. Developers find it difficult to control the output generated by ChatGPT, especially when it comes to understanding context and user preferences. In addition, depending completely on the ChatGPT model can be a risk if the model does not fully understand the demands of the project or generates inappropriate code.The implication of this research is that the use of ChatGPT in front-end development with ReactJS can increase the efficiency and creativity of developers, but it is necessary to consider the challenges and risks associated. Implementing ChatGPT in front-end development can provide huge advantages, provided developers are able to leverage it effectively and manage the resulting output.","PeriodicalId":517517,"journal":{"name":"Jurnal Media Computer Science","volume":" 31","pages":""},"PeriodicalIF":0.0000,"publicationDate":"2024-03-20","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"The Impact of Chatgpt In Front-End Development With A Focus On Reactjs\",\"authors\":\"Abubakar Bachtiar, Rian Andrian\",\"doi\":\"10.37676/jmcs.v3i1.4361\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"This article analyzes the impact of using ChatGPT in front-end development with a focus on the ReactJS framework. Through interviews with front-end developers who have used ChatGPT, we evaluate their experience implementing ChatGPT in web application development with ReactJS.The results of the analysis show that using ChatGPT in front-end development, especially with ReactJS, has a positive impact. Developers report significant improvements in development speed, a wider range of idea exploration capabilities, and an increase in overall productivity. They appreciated ChatGPT's ability to provide coding suggestions and solutions that helped speed up the development process.However, several challenges were also identified. Developers find it difficult to control the output generated by ChatGPT, especially when it comes to understanding context and user preferences. In addition, depending completely on the ChatGPT model can be a risk if the model does not fully understand the demands of the project or generates inappropriate code.The implication of this research is that the use of ChatGPT in front-end development with ReactJS can increase the efficiency and creativity of developers, but it is necessary to consider the challenges and risks associated. Implementing ChatGPT in front-end development can provide huge advantages, provided developers are able to leverage it effectively and manage the resulting output.\",\"PeriodicalId\":517517,\"journal\":{\"name\":\"Jurnal Media Computer Science\",\"volume\":\" 31\",\"pages\":\"\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2024-03-20\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Jurnal Media Computer Science\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.37676/jmcs.v3i1.4361\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Jurnal Media Computer Science","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.37676/jmcs.v3i1.4361","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
The Impact of Chatgpt In Front-End Development With A Focus On Reactjs
This article analyzes the impact of using ChatGPT in front-end development with a focus on the ReactJS framework. Through interviews with front-end developers who have used ChatGPT, we evaluate their experience implementing ChatGPT in web application development with ReactJS.The results of the analysis show that using ChatGPT in front-end development, especially with ReactJS, has a positive impact. Developers report significant improvements in development speed, a wider range of idea exploration capabilities, and an increase in overall productivity. They appreciated ChatGPT's ability to provide coding suggestions and solutions that helped speed up the development process.However, several challenges were also identified. Developers find it difficult to control the output generated by ChatGPT, especially when it comes to understanding context and user preferences. In addition, depending completely on the ChatGPT model can be a risk if the model does not fully understand the demands of the project or generates inappropriate code.The implication of this research is that the use of ChatGPT in front-end development with ReactJS can increase the efficiency and creativity of developers, but it is necessary to consider the challenges and risks associated. Implementing ChatGPT in front-end development can provide huge advantages, provided developers are able to leverage it effectively and manage the resulting output.